What is it? A spy-thriller expansion for Cyberpunk 2077
When can I play it? September 26
What can I play it on? PlayStation 5, Xbox Series X|S, PC
Who is making it? CD Projekt

The Phantom Liberty release date is September 26 this year - just shy of three years since the base game was released, and over a year since the first announcement and teaser was released. The initial announcement for the expansion was made in 2022 but didn’t feature a specific release date and offered a vague window of 2023 instead. So, now we have a concrete date, we can start looking into how the expansion will shake up the Cyberpunk formula.

As for platforms, Phantom Liberty will only be available on PlayStation 5, Xbox Series X|S, and PC. So, for those who enjoyed their first adventure in Night City on previous-generation hardware, we’ve got some bad news. Following CD Projekt Red’s decision to phase out development for older consoles, as announced after the Edgerunners update, any content regarding Cyberpunk 2077 and its expansions is now exclusively being created for current-gen hardware.

That said, Phantom Liberty is currently the only planned expansion for the game, and the sacrifice of not developing the content for last-generation consoles was made to assist the performance and combat repeating the same issues reported by players upon 2077’s initial release. The Cyberpunk 2077 Phantom Liberty story follows the story of V, who you would’ve met in Cyberpunk 2077. As a government-led, cyber-enhanced mercenary, V must undertake a high-stakes mission of espionage and intrigue in an attempt to save the NUS President, but the road isn’t exactly easy. Along the way, you’ll need to forge alliances with unexpected characters in a web of secrets to unravel while experiencing the shadowy world of spycraft firsthand.

V will be taking on the challenge of a location called Dogtown, a city-within-a-city ruled by trigger-happy militia. Within its crumbling walls, you’ll undergo trials and challenges which put all new pieces of cyberware and weapons to the test. As you’d expect from the overarching story of saving the NUS President, failure isn’t exactly an option, so you’ll need to choose your alliances carefully, since you’ll never know who will really have your back when you need it most.

Dogtown promises to transport us to an entirely new district of Night City, confirming that we will be free to visit a previously unexplored area. It’s been labeled as one of the most dangerous areas of the Night City, making it the perfect setting for a spy-thriller escapade, albeit an intimidating location to jump into. Even the authority of the city, the Barghest, is described to be more dangerous than the NCPD.

However, Dogtown has also been confirmed during an overview to be a vibrant location, where special attention has been paid to creating an immersive and more believable atmosphere by implementing small scenes involving NPCs alongside numerous easter eggs. Currently, the newest elements of the game revolve around the extensive armory to explore as V, and since Dogtown disobeys the standards and expectations of central Night City, there is a lot of illegal weaponry and goods to discover within its walls.

But a number of new mechanics and features to utilize throughout the expansion alongside new cyberware and weapons have been spotlighted, including an entirely new skill tree to ensure V is always on top form among a world of hustlers, cunning netrunners, and additional mercenaries bent on profit and power.

Dogtown may be tough, but Phantom Liberty’s protagonist is bound to be tougher. In a three-minute overview shown at the Xbox Extended Showcase, the Quest Director Pawl Sasko takes us through Dogtown’s Black Market, the one-stop shop for new enhancements, cyberware, and weaponry V will utilize during the intense gigs and missions throughout the story.

In the same overview, we are reassured that actions are more believable, dynamic, and diverse, which was one of the main issues voiced by players during the release period of Cyberpunk 2077.
